Features & Benefits

Rubber expansion joints (REJs) are primarily used to absorb all directional piping movements as well as reduce noise and vibration. In addition, they are a cost-effective means to relieve piping and anchor stresses, compensate for misalignment, and provide access to piping and equipment.

Case Studies

General Rubber has created case studies to communicate our extensive capabilities across multiple industries and sectors. Good illustrations include our case studies on developing 12 foot diameter dismantling expansion joints for the world’s largest common cooling water system (Ras Laffan, Qatar) and developing an all rubber in-line pressure balanced expansion joint, used within newly constructed AP1000 nuclear plants (VC Summer 2,3/Vogtle 3,4).
